TC90A53N/F
TOSHIBA CMOS DIGITAL INTEGRATED CIRCUIT SILICON MONOLITHIC
TC90A53N,TC90A53F
3-LINE DIGITAL Y / C SEPARATOR IC
TC90A53N / F is a 3-line digital Y / C separator IC which separates
luminance signal Y and chroma signal C from composite video signals.
Toshiba’s logical comb filter realizes good Y / C separation at low cost.
FEATURES
·
TV format : NTSC (3.58)
·
Dynamic comb filter
·
Vertical edge enhancement circuit
·
PLL 4 × multiplier circuit
·
Internal 8-bit 4 fsc AD converter
·
Internal 8-bit 4 fsc DA converter (2 ch)
·
1-line color dot interference reducer circuit
·
Sync tip clamp circuit
·
Internal 2H-line memory
·
Color killer mode (Y / C separation off)
·
Chroma signal C output wide band mode
·
Package : SDIP 28-pin and SOP 28-pin
·
5 V single power supply
Weight:
SDIP28-P-400-1.78: 1.7 g (Typ.)
SOP28-P-450-1.27: 0.8 g (Typ.)
